Senior Engagement & Retention Manager
The V&A is looking for a strategic engagement leader to drive how our members connect, renew and spend.
As Senior Engagement & Retention Manager, you’ll oversee data‑led communications, new benefits, and member experiences that deliver high levels of engagement and renewal and influence secondary spend across our shops, cafes, and events.
If you’re passionate about loyalty, storytelling, and bringing data to life through exceptional experiences, join the team shaping the future of membership at the V&A.
Role Responsibilities
- Develop and implement a comprehensive membership retention strategy, using data‑driven insight and personalised communication to increase renewal rates and deliver significant revenue targets.
- Lead cross‑team initiatives to grow member engagement and secondary spend, aligning colleagues across the organisation to drive income from on‑site and digital channels.
- Oversee the membership content and communications strategy, ensuring messaging is targeted, automated, and consistent with the brand’s tone of voice across all lifecycle stages.
- Manage key external relationships and budgets, including print vendors and the V&A Magazine, ensuring operational excellence, innovation, and strong return on investment.
- Use market insight and regulatory expertise (including GDPR and consumer policy) to inform strategy, test new approaches, and ensure compliance in all member communications.
- Champion membership across the organisation, developing new products and benefits, promoting best practice in engagement and retention, and acting as deputy to the Head of Membership when required.
What We’re Looking For
- 5+ years in strategic retention and engagement leadership, driving retention and engagement planning across multiple income streams and channels, responsible for KPIs, forecasting and long‑term value strategy.
- Experience of developing a commercial strategy and delivering results against defined targets.
- Demonstrable use of evaluation frameworks to benchmark engagement success (qualitative and quantitative).
- Experience of working in a complex organisation with a multi‑stakeholder environment, able to synthesize a range of views, influence and build consensus.
- Strong analytical skills – the ability to interpret data and trends.
- Experience managing budgets.
- Insight‑driven strategy experience – using advanced analytical skills and working with segmentation, lifetime value modelling and ROI evaluation.
